Understanding Asbestos Exposure and Its Connection to Lung Cancer
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was commonly used in building products, insulation, and numerous commercial applications due to its fire-resistant properties. However, extended exposure to asbestos fibers can result in serious health issues, including lung cancer, asbestosis, and mesothelioma-- an uncommon cancer mainly affecting the lining of the lungs.

The Legal Framework for Asbestos-Related Claims
When it concerns looking for compensation for asbestos-related conditions like lung cancer, victims may pursue legal action through various opportunities:
Personal Injury Lawsuits: Individuals diagnosed with lung cancer due to asbestos exposure can submit accident lawsuits against makers, employers, or other celebrations responsible for the exposure.
Wrongful Death Lawsuits: If an enjoyed one has died from lung cancer triggered by asbestos exposure, member of the family might file a wrongful death lawsuit to seek compensation for their loss.
Asbestos Trust Funds: Many companies that manufactured or sold asbestos-containing products have actually developed trust funds to compensate victims. People might file claims against these funds without the requirement for lengthy legal battles.
Employees' Compensation Claims: If the individual was exposed to asbestos in the work environment, they may be eligible for employees' compensation benefits despite fault.

Frequently Asked QuestionsQ1: How long do I need to submit a lawsuit for asbestos-related lung cancer in Louisiana Mesothelioma?A1: Louisiana Asbestos Exposure Lung Cancer Legal Help has particular statutes of limitations for filing individual injury and wrongful death claims. Typically, the time limit is one year from the date of the diagnosis or death. Q2: What sort of compensation might I get?A2: Compensation varies based on various elements, consisting of severity of the illness, medical expenditures, lost salaries, and discomfort and suffering. Q3: Can I file a claim if I worked for several employers?A3: Yes, you might have premises to file claims versus multiple parties if you were exposed to asbestos while working for various companies. Q4: What should I consist of in my medical records?A4: Include all pertinent medical diagnoses, treatments, occupational exposure details, and any diagnostic tests, such as imaging or biopsies. Q5: How do trust funds work for asbestos claims?A5: Trust funds are established by companies that have applied for personal bankruptcy due to asbestos liabilities. Victims can submit claims to these funds for compensation without going through the conventional lawsuit process.
